Join us to enjoy the vibrant seaside charm of Brighton

Enjoy a blend of modern culture and exotic architecture, sea and countryside in Brighton

 

Enjoy a stroll along the iconic Brighton Palace Pier, relax on the pebbled beach or explore the eclectic shops and cafes in the Lanes with us this August.

Be sure to visit the exotic Royal Pavilion, built in 1787 for King George IV, a unique blend of Regency grandeur with Indian and Chinese influences.

 

With its thriving arts scene, diverse culinary offerings, and lively atmosphere, Brighton promises an unforgettable experience.
